Stormin Mormon writes:

Mighta worked on rubber AC hoses, but I doubt it will do
much good on copper.


A 1/16" hole in a 300 psi line requires less than a pound of force to seal.
well within the capabilities of a scrap of rubber convered with a hose
clamp.

Another technique is to whip with copper wire and then solder.

Analysis and improvisation work when the "correct" stuff isn't at hand, or
too costly, often better. Many factory parts are cost-reduced to bare
minimum performance for the task, and you can cobble up something stronger
than the original.
